Solution
To automate technical documentation for employee exit processing in e-commerce, we recommend implementing a custom solution using a combination of existing tools and services.
Tool Selection
- Documentation Management Platform: Utilize a platform like Confluence or SharePoint to create and manage technical documentation. These platforms offer robust features for collaboration, version control, and searchability.
- Automated Workflow Engine: Leverage a workflow engine like Zapier or Automate.io to automate the employee exit processing workflow. This will ensure that all necessary tasks are completed efficiently and accurately.
- Integration with HR System: Integrate the automated workflow with the company’s Human Resources Information System (HRIS) to fetch relevant employee data, such as job titles, departments, and previous positions.
Custom Solution
- Create a custom workflow using the chosen workflow engine that triggers when an employee exits the company.
- Use the documentation management platform to create and store technical documentation specific to each employee’s position and responsibilities.
- Develop a script or bot that automates the extraction of relevant data from the HRIS, such as job titles, departments, and previous positions.
- Use the extracted data to populate the custom documentation template in the documentation management platform.
Example Workflow
- Employee submits exit request through company intranet
- Automated workflow engine triggers, initiating employee exit processing
- Script or bot extracts relevant data from HRIS
- Custom documentation template is populated with extracted data
- Document is saved to documentation management platform for review and approval
